Output 23df3df52aee366dd3d2a443ea204426da4f2e6a6cf90a02f7fee8a6b03cfb8a:3

value
99529
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 739841d54864cb99b63b098583ec049fffb06ced OP_EQUALVERIFY OP_CHECKSIG
address
1BYD75GCsh2VWP66f6ymTjf2HyRnXo9yWA
transaction
23df3df52aee366dd3d2a443ea204426da4f2e6a6cf90a02f7fee8a6b03cfb8a
confirmations
162958
spent
true